Many utilize the terms "hot water removal" and "heavy steam cleaning" mutually, but there are some distinctions between the two. Warm water extraction can set you back in between $100 as well as $500. This cleaning technique uses high stress to deliver warm water and occasionally a cleaning representative to liquify dirt as well as crud. The solution is then vacuumed up, yet it can take a day or 2 to completely dry.

Vapor cleansing entails home heating water hotter than for hot water extraction, so practically all the fluid water is developed into a vapor. It's a reliable means to kill bacteria and allergens, but steam cleaning doesn't raise have a peek here the pile of the carpet, meaning it doesn't clean as deeply into the fibers as warm water removal would certainly.

Dry cleaning is a low-moisture approach of rug cleaning. Dry cleansing utilizes a dry formula of solvents and also cleaning up agents that stick to dust. After sitting for concerning 10 to 15 mins, the formula and dust will certainly be vacuumed away with powerful suction. This approach isn't a deep clean, but it does get rid of dust, particles, and smells.

Dry cleaning expense ranges from $75 to $350. Encapsulation is a popular cleansing technique because of the quick drying out time of one to 2 hours. This method uses a brush machine to use a foam or liquid cleaner to the carpeting, forming a powder. Dust as well as particles end up being enveloped within the powder, which is vacuumed away.


Expect to pay between $75 and also $350 for this kind of rug cleansing. Bonnet cleansing focuses on a shallow tidy as opposed to a deep-down cleaning of the carpeting fibers. A cleaning solution-soaked spinning pad on a mechanized device spins over the carpeting's surface to eliminate dust and debris - care carpet cleaning. The pad will need to be washed or changed frequently considering that it will certainly absorb dirt rapidly.




Bonnet cleaning typically runs in between $25 and also $85. Carbonated cleansing expenses between $125 as well as $550, on average. This process uses hot water and chemical bubbles to function out ground-in dust in the rug fibers, which is then vacuumed. This cleaning method uses marginal water for a fast dry time.
